Description:
Because krappy™ graphics cards deserve transparency too!
I'm rolling this app over to the Widgets section, as the KWin JavaScript API is not playing nice. Stay tuned! When we disappear here, we should be there.
Simple implementation of the KWin JavaScript API to allow window transparency when not obviously available in settings. Seemingly, this is due to an unsupported graphics card.
Reccommended to install from the System Settings -> Window Management -> KWin Scripts GUI. Last changelog:

0.2.1 - Custom opacity
Set custom opacity in the script settings menu. Please see README.md for limitations (restart is required, KWin API isn't behaving as expected).
